> Hello,>> I am working as an intern with Dr. Ciccarelli at the IU School of Medicine Center for Youth and Adults with Conditions of Childhood (CYACC). We have a partnership with Down Syndrome Indiana to create a peer and caregiver curriculum around transition to adult life and self- management skills for youth and young adults with intellectual disabilities. The Welcome to Adult Life modules focus on a variety of topics, including education and employment, health care and healthy habits, decision making, community participation and relationships. We want the training to be meaningful to those who participate, and we would like to ask for your help in the design of the program.
